Reviving a Forgotten Promise: The HTTP 402 Code

Picture a digital universe where accessing content online is as effortless as sending a few coins. Originally envisioned in the infancy of the web, the HTTP 402 code aimed to simplify direct payments for digital content access. Unfortunately, that vision was thwarted by an inability to establish scalable micropayment systems.

As a result, the internet chose the ad-based revenue model, fostering a pervasive surveillance economy reliant on tracking user behavior. Marc Andreessen deemed this predicament the original sin of the web; without a direct mechanism for pricing content, we found ourselves beholden to advertisers. Yet, as optimism flickers on the horizon, the re-emergence of HTTP 402 offers a chance to correct this oversight, paving the way for an effortlessly smooth user experience in digital transactions.

The Emergence of L402 and x402 Protocols

As the revival unfolds, two main players have risen: L402 and x402. Emerging from the Bitcoin landscape, the L402 protocol marries payment processes with cryptographic security in a decentralized framework. This streamlined design cuts out intermediaries, ensuring transactions are both swift and secure.

Conversely, the x402 protocol, born from the collaboration of Coinbase and Cloudflare, adopts a user-centric approach focused on scalability and engagement. By accommodating both AI-driven transactions and human users, x402 seeks to facilitate native payments across the web using stablecoins like USDC. The recent spike in activity only underlines the significance of these protocols; notably, x402 recently documented a staggering uptick of over 10,000% in transaction volume, proof of its burgeoning relevance.

Bridging User Experience with Payment Psychology

Despite the technological advancements, a psychological hurdle continues to loiter around the concept of micropayments. The notion of mental transaction costs can be off-putting for users, who may view even minuscule payments as an inconvenience.

To dismantle this barrier, creative payment designs are essential. Envision a billing system that consolidates transactions into a single monthly statement, much like traditional utility bills. This approach diminishes the complexity and friction typically linked to micropayments, thus fostering a frictionless engagement with online content, free from the distraction of inconsequential costs.
